On 03 March 2006 16:39, Christian Franke wrote: > Hi, > > with the current cygwin1.dll 20050203, ls.exe hangs on access of an > inaccessible directory if ntsec is turned off. > > Steps to reproduce on XP Prof: > > $ CYGWIN=ntsec ls "/cygdrive/c/System Volume Information" > ls: /cygdrive/c/System Volume Information: Permission denied > # OK > > $ CYGWIN=nontsec ls "/cygdrive/c/System Volume Information" > ls: /cygdrive/c/System Volume Information: Permission denied > # *** ls hangs with 100% CPU *** > > Bug is present since cygwin1.dll 20050128, 20050127 was OK. > > Christian
It appears to be running to completion and then hitting an infinite loop at (gdb) info symbol 0x61002148 [EMAIL PROTECTED] + 40 in section .text which is called from exit().
